Energy flows through; matter goes round
- An ecosystem 生态系统 is the organisms in an area plus the non-living conditions they live in.
- Producers 生产者 make their own food from sunlight. Consumers 消费者 eat others. Decomposers 分解者 return nutrients to the soil.
- The two verbs matter: energy flows through and is lost; matter cycles and is reused.

Why food chains are short
- About 90% of the energy at each level is lost — as heat, and in the work of staying alive.
- After four transfers roughly one part in ten thousand of the original energy remains.
- That is not enough to support another level of predators, which is why a chain of five links is already unusual.
Biodiversity
- Biodiversity 生物多样性 is the variety of life in an ecosystem.
- It matters because variety is what lets an ecosystem absorb change: if one species fails, another can do its job.
- ⚠ An ecosystem with one dominant species is productive and fragile, and the fragility only shows when something goes wrong.

Why there are no fifth-level predators.
Start with 10,000 units of energy captured by plants.
Herbivores get about 1,000. Their predators get 100. The next level gets 10. The next would have 1.
An animal cannot live on a thousandth of what the plants captured, so the chain stops — and this is an energy argument, not an ecological accident.

Answer food-chain questions in energy terms. "There is not enough food" is the observation; "about 90% is lost at each transfer, so the fifth level has too little to sustain a population" is the explanation, and only the second earns the marks.

Do not say that decomposers "get rid of" waste. They return nutrients to the soil, which is the step that closes the matter cycle — without them the nutrients would be locked in dead material and the producers would stop.
